1. Niacinamides
Niacinamide, the water-soluble form of vitamin B3, is the new beauty favorite. And why not? This ingredient has the power to help your skin by boosting the production of ceramides and keratinocytes, or skin strengtheners. Your skin becomes firmer, while blocking out environmental stressors like pollution or smoke.
By aiding your skin’s growth, you’ll see an increase in your skin’s total health. Niacinamides, for example, can get rid of redness, decrease breakouts, and banish blotchiness. This amazing vitamin even helps to diminish large pores, while increasing your skin’s moisture. Add in brightening properties and collagen production, things especially beneficial in anti-wrinkle eye cream, and you can see why niacinamides are gaining a cult following in skincare products across the board.
2. Ceramides
You’ve probably heard of wrinkle-smoothing retinol (otherwise known as vitamin A), found in anti-wrinkle cream, but ceramides also play an important role in skincare, making them a great substance to work in tandem with retinol. In the case of ceramides, their power lies in adding vital moisture back to the skin and in the overall health and condition of your skin. In fact, ceramides play a huge role in how your skin looks and feels as a whole.
It’s little wonder, when you consider how ceramides make up about 50 percent of your skin’s composition. Their ability to provide protection against environmental stressors keeps your skin from becoming rough, dry, and wrinkly. But ceramides replenish your body’s natural ceramides, resulting in naturally plumper, firmer skin (and fewer fine lines to boot). Anti-aging eye cream with ceramides is a go-to item for anyone wanting to improve their skin (and lessen the appearance of crow’s feet).
3. Vitamin C
Vitamin C may be associated with keeping immune systems healthy, and it does, but vitamin C happens to be a powerful skin booster too. There are different types of vitamin C, but L-ascorbic acid is the magic ingredient you want when it comes to choosing an anti-aging face cream, serum, or mask.
Dull skin benefits from L-ascorbic acid products, brightening and evening out skin tone in a big way when used as part of a beauty routine. No matter how you look at it, vitamin C is a great way to get healthy, glowing skin. Make products containing vitamin C a part of your beauty routine, and watch your ho-hum skin glow again.
